This study aims to determine the extent to which the social environment influences the tendency of students' career choices. The approach used is quantitative, with the analysis method in the form of multiple linear regression. A total of 150 active students from Nurul Huda University, East OKU acted as respondents in this study. Econometrics is a discipline in economics that combines economic theory, mathematics, and statistics to quantitatively assess economic phenomena. This paper aims to introduce econometrics as an important tool in economic analysis and explain its applications in various sectors such as macroeconomics, microeconomics, development, and finance. The issue of fairness in regional development in Indonesia remains a significant challenge, particularly concerning the disparities between urban and rural areas, Java and outside Java, as well as between the western and eastern regions of Indonesia. This imbalance reflects an uneven distribution of investments influenced by the national political-economic structure. This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of the inquiry learning model in improving learning activities and student learning outcomes in the classroom using the Classroom Action Research (PTK) method, data were collected from two cycles conducted in the same class. The results showed a significant increase in teacher and student activities, with the average teacher activity increasing from 62.49% to 87.49% and student activity from 60.46% to 85.04%.
